As you may know, vouchers are a form of public funding that allows parents to use public money to pay for private school tuition. While this may sound like a good idea on the surface, vouchers actually have a number of negative effects on our public schools.
First and foremost, vouchers drain much-needed resources from our public schools. When parents use vouchers to send their children to private schools, the public schools lose funding that they desperately need to provide a quality education to all students. This means that the students who remain in public schools are left with fewer resources and fewer opportunities.
In addition, vouchers can exacerbate existing inequalities in our education system. Parents who can afford to supplement the voucher with additional funds can send their children to the best private schools, while those who cannot afford to do so are left with limited choices. This can lead to a two-tiered education system, where only the wealthiest families have access to the best schools.
